This episode discusses a multifaceted view of the rapid growth and regulatory landscape of Artificial Intelligence in China, highlighting both the technological advancements and the strategic governmental approach. One source details China's leading "Six Tigers" AI unicorn companies—such as Zhipu AI and MiniMax—describing their origins, funding, and innovative large language models, positioning them as rivals to Western AI leaders. Another source utilizes the Artificial Analysis Intelligence Index to demonstrate that China’s frontier language models are quickly closing the intelligence gap with US models, reducing the lead from over a year to less than three months. The final source examines China's "bifurcated" AI regulatory strategy, arguing that recent legislative measures, despite appearances of control, are intentionally lenient and pro-growth, aimed at coordinating a "whole of society" effort to accelerate AI development and gain a short-term competitive advantage over the European Union and the United States, although this leniency introduces substantial safety risks.
